Ginjari Profile

Ginjari is a 4 year old chestnut mare. Ginjari is trained by Luke Clarke, at Braidwood and owned by L Clarke, Mrs K Clarke, Mrs T D Nadin, C L Nadin, G J Wakeling, B S Blanchard, Mrs S L Blanchard, D Shiels, S J Green, Mrs K Green, K Sissons, Miss M Henry, M Kain, P A Weir & Mrs T M Weir.
